Perhaps the greatest impact of terminal groins and jetties leads to the long-term effect on barrier islands and the effect that may have on marine and estuarine ecosystems. By stabilizing the inlet, inlet migration and overwash processes are interrupted, causing a cascade of different results . In the case of Oregon Inlet, the terminal groin anchored the bridge to Pea Island and stopped the migration of the inlet on the south side. But the continuing migration of the north finish of Bodie Island led to an increased need for inlet dredging. With overwash processes disrupted, the beach profile has steepened, and the island has flattened and narrowed, growing vulnerability to storm harm (Dolan et al. 2006; Riggs and Ames 2009; Riggs et al. 2009).

However, many of the sand along the world's beaches comes from rivers and streams. When natural processes are interfered with, the pure supply of sand is interrupted and the seaside changes shape or can disappear utterly. Sand production stops when coral reefs die from pollution, when coastal bluffs are "armored" by sea walls and when rivers are dammed or channelized upstream for flood control and reservoir building.
